Freigeben über


STORAGE_SPEC_VERSION Union (ntddstor.h)

Gibt die Spezifikation des Speichergeräts an.

Syntax

typedef union _STORAGE_SPEC_VERSION {
  struct {
    union {
      struct {
        UCHAR SubMinor;
        UCHAR Minor;
      } DUMMYSTRUCTNAME;
      USHORT AsUshort;
    } MinorVersion;
    USHORT MajorVersion;
  } DUMMYSTRUCTNAME;
  ULONG  AsUlong;
} STORAGE_SPEC_VERSION, *PSTORAGE_SPEC_VERSION;

Angehörige

DUMMYSTRUCTNAME

Die Haupt- und Nebenversion der Speicherspezifikation.

DUMMYSTRUCTNAME.MinorVersion

Die Nebenversion der Speicherspezifikation.

DUMMYSTRUCTNAME.MinorVersion.DUMMYSTRUCTNAME

Die Neben- und Unterversion der Speicherspezifikation.

DUMMYSTRUCTNAME.MinorVersion.DUMMYSTRUCTNAME.SubMinor

Die Unter-Nebenversion der Speicherspezifikation.

DUMMYSTRUCTNAME.MinorVersion.DUMMYSTRUCTNAME.Minor

Die Nebenversion der Speicherspezifikation.

DUMMYSTRUCTNAME.MinorVersion.AsUshort

Die Kombination aus den Nebenversionen und SubMinor Versionen der Speicherspezifikation.

DUMMYSTRUCTNAME.MajorVersion

Die Hauptversion der Speicherspezifikation.

AsUlong

Die Kombination aus den MajorVersion und MinorVersion Versionen der Speicherspezifikation.

Bemerkungen

Diese Union ermöglicht die Angabe der Speicherspezifikationsversion, z. B. SBC 3, SATA 3.2 und NVMe 1.2.

Anforderungen

Anforderung Wert
Header- ntddstor.h (include Ntddstor.h)